    Give a little money to James Tynion IV and the Harvey Pekar family

    The comics community is always supporting its own, and a couple of requests came out this weekend, one helping a new organization do cool things, another securing the historical legacy of a comics original. 

    § The first is James Tynion IV asking for $5. You can read his whole Substack appeal here, but it’s about BODEGA (Brooklyn Organization Dedicated to the Endurance of the Graphic Arts) while will be putting on BEC (Brooklyn Expo of Comics) this fall. They have more in the works, he writes:

    BEC is just the beginning of what we are planning with BODEGA. Like with many of my ventures, I’m not really one to think small. From other events celebrating the myriad other corners of the comics medium, to special grants to comic creators, there’s a lot we want to get done. And now that our plans for BEC are locking in, we’re getting ready to start building the internal infrastructure we need to start accomplishing these dreams for 2027 and beyond.

    If there’s an ethos that I ought to have absorbed from my years in superhero comics, it’s probably the most powerful moral code that genre ever put into the world. With Great Power Comes Great Responsibility. I love comics. I owe my life and my success to this medium and its fans. I am in a position to directly and materially help the artistic medium I love so much, and the community in which I live and work. But there’s only so much I can fund out of my own pocket.

    Tynion’s ask is $5 to help things get going, while they plan bigger fundraisers. Honestly, I think this is $5 well spent. Tiny Onion has already been doing so much in front of and behind the scenes, and Tynion has got my vote as someone who has been actively working to make comics better. Smash that donation button! 

    § The second is a Kickstarter to help save four storage units full of the paperwork of Harvey Pekar and Joyce Brabner.The campaign is organized by Danielle, their adopted daughter, and she is planning the job of going through the four units and digitizing their papers. 

    I am the real Danielle from American Splendor. I grew up in Harvey Pekar and Joyce Brabner’s household. Right now, forty years of their raw, unfiltered creative history is sitting across four massive storage units. With urgent deadlines looming to clear and secure these spaces, I am stepping up independently to physically protect, sort, and digitally archive this legacy before it is lost.

    This project is completely independent of the estate and outside court administrators. Your support directly funds the physical preservation—archival boxes, document sleeves, climate protection, and my dedicated time to go through thousands of pages of history.

    Pekar’s American Splendor is one of the great comics narratives of every day life, and Brabner’s work as an activist and author also had tremendous impact. They worked with a ton of notable cartoonists, and who knows what is in those storage units. 

    For fans of comics history, this is another project worthy of support. The campaign is for $12,000 and it’s about halfway there, but only two weeks to go, so send Danielle a few bucks.
